Zinaida Slobodzyan

Speaker
Head of the scientific direction of the theory and history of musical art of the Council of Young Scientists, St. Petersburg State Conservatory named after N. A. Rimsky-Korsakov.
Russia
Born in St. Petersburg. Graduated with honors from the N. A. Pskov Regional School of Arts with a degree in music theory; since 2017 — a student at the N. A. Rimsky-Korsakov St. Petersburg State Conservatory. Her research interests are English folk music, the musical culture of England in the XX-XXI centuries. Participant of international scientific and scientific-practical conferences "Studies of Young Musicologists" (Moscow), "Music in the modern world: Culture, Art, Education" (Moscow), "Lomonosov" (Moscow), "Ethnomusicology: History, Theory, Practice" (St. Petersburg). Author of publications on foreign and Russian music.
